Chiral Anomaly Beyond Lorentz Invariance

High Energy Physics - Theory 2008-11-26 v3 High Energy Physics - Phenomenology

Abstract

The chiral anomaly in the context of an extended standard model with minimal Lorentz invariance violation is studied. Taking into account bounds from measurements of the speed of light, we argue that the chiral anomaly and its consequences are general results valid even beyond the relativistic symmetry.
